They used to sell something called podpiwek in Polish food shops. It was a powder mix and with it you could create a beer-like beverage. Is it still available? I never made it but I did try it. The beer came out yeasty and cloudy but supposedly such were the beers of yesteryear -- cloudy, with sediment and not very bubbly. Nothing like today's ultra-filtered, golden, fizzy lagers.
